一、概述
MySQL-HA目前有很多实现方案,今天就用MySQL双master+keepalived来实现MySQL-HA。
在MySQL-HA环境中,MySQL互为主从关系,这样就保证了两台MySQL数据的一致性。
然后用keepalived实现虚拟IP,通过keepalived来实现MySQL故障时自动切换。
二、实验环境
虚拟机
IP
操作系统
vCPU/个
内存/G
硬盘/G
备注
Mysql01
192.168.1.100
Ubuntu14.04
1
1
20
Mysql02
192.168.1.101
Ubuntu14.04
1
1
20
三、mysql-server-5.6安装
安装过程省略
四、配置Mysql双主架构
4.1、在两台服务器上同时创建用于“复制的账号”
mysql> GRANT REPLICATION SLAVE, REPLICATION CLIENT ON *.* TO copy_user@'192.168.1.%' IDENTIFIED BY '1qaz#EDC';
说明:复制账户:copy_user 密码&#x